Analysis Note

routinely evaluated in immunocytochemistry by immunostaining chromatin in HeLa cells undergoing mitosis

Application

Anti-phospho-Histone H3 (Ser10) Antibody, biotin conjugate is a Rabbit Polyclonal Antibody for detection of Histone H3 phosphorylated at serine 10. This purified mAb, also known as H3S10p,is biotinylated, published in peer reviewed journals and has been validated in WB, ICC.

Immunogen

KLH-conjugated peptide (ARK[pS]TGGKAPRKQL- C) corresponding to amino acids 7-20 of human histone H3.

Physical form

PBS, pH 7.4, with 0.05% sodium azide.
Protein A purified
